Existence of Mean Curvature Flow Singularities with Bounded Mean Curvature

Abstract

In [Vel94], Velazquez constructed a countable collection of mean curvature flow solutions in RN in every dimension N 8. Each of these solutions becomes singular in finite time at which time the second fundamental form blows up. In contrast, we confirm here that, in every dimension N 8, a nontrivial subset of these solutions has uniformly bounded mean curvature.
